Russia – EU Trade Continues to Decline in January-March 2020

  • During January-March 2020, the trade turnover between Russia and the countries of the European Union decreased by 10.1% year-on-year down to 52.3 bn euro.

    According to Eurostat, import from EU countries into Russia was up 4.6% in Q1 2020 making 20.6 bn euro. Export from Russia to the European Union declined by 17.7% down to 31.7 bn euro.

    Russia rates the fifth among the largest importers from the EU after the USA, the United Kingdom, China and Switzerland.

    Among the largest exporters to the EU countries, Russia rates the fourth after China, the USA, and the UK.
